WELL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

817 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Welltower (WELL)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$37.4B — down 11% from $42.1B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 89 funds closed out of WELL and 74 opened new positions — a net loss of 15 holders — while 257 trimmed existing stakes and 316 added.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$376M. The largest seller was Cohen & Steers, cutting an estimated $94.8M.
